The curtain will rise at 7 p.m. on Friday, March 8 and Saturday, March 9 in the Deibel Morley Arts Center for the production of William Shakespeare’s comedy, “Much Ado About Nothing.” Benedick and Beatrice are tricked into confessing their love for each other, and Claudio is tricked into rejecting Hero at the altar on the erroneous belief that she has been unfaithful. At the end, Benedick and Beatrice join forces to set things right, and the others join in a dance celebrating the marriages of the two couples.
Tickets will be for sale at the Box Office the evening of the performances. The play is being directed by Mrs. Joan Williams.
